Output dfbcca438788780520b2acbc59fff702efb85eea6fc55d6d4fc85a6a53e2393d:22

value
238893
script pubkey
OP_0 OP_PUSHBYTES_20 d3ec648134aa79e5fa1c83648febb4f627e6c080
address
bc1q60kxfqf54fu7t7susdjgl6a57cn7dsyqrfhfd5
transaction
dfbcca438788780520b2acbc59fff702efb85eea6fc55d6d4fc85a6a53e2393d
confirmations
174693
spent
true